SimpleInjector是一个轻量级的依赖注入(DI)容器,用于在应用程序中管理对象的创建和解析。它是一个开源的.NET框架,适用于前端开发、后端开发和移动开发等各种应用场景。
SimpleInjector的主要特点包括:
SimpleInjector适用于各种应用场景,包括Web应用程序、桌面应用程序、移动应用程序和服务端应用程序等。它可以帮助开发人员实现松耦合的架构,提高代码的可测试性和可维护性。
在腾讯云的产品生态中,推荐使用腾讯云的Serverless Framework(https://cloud.tencent.com/product/sls)来配合SimpleInjector进行开发。Serverless Framework是一个开发框架,可以帮助开发人员快速构建和部署无服务器应用程序。它与SimpleInjector的轻量级特性相互补充,可以提供更好的开发体验和性能。
总结:SimpleInjector是一个轻量级的依赖注入容器,适用于各种应用场景。它具有简单易用、高性能、灵活性和可扩展性等特点。在腾讯云的产品生态中,可以使用Serverless Framework来配合SimpleInjector进行开发。
领取专属 10元无门槛券
手把手带您无忧上云